(June 3, 1919 - July 6, 2007)
Edith E. Terrill, age 88 of Henderson, AR, formerly of Harrison passed away Friday, July 6, 2007 at the Hospice House in Mountain Home, AR.
The daughter of Lynn and Audrey (Harlin) Adams was born June 3, 1919 in Tomahawk, AR.
She was of the Baptist faith and has been a lifelong resident of this area and is a homemaker.
Her parents preceded her in death along with her husband, Steven Terrill; a daughter, Joetta Terrill; a grandson, Jerry Terrill; and a step-daughter, Edith Mae Baker.
Survivors are her sons, Lee Terrill and his wife, Faye of Everton, AR, Dale Terrill and his wife, Barbara of Odessa, MO, James Terrill and his wife, Brenda of Henderson, AR, Ricky Terrill and his wife, Rita of Harrison, and Bill Terrill of Lonejack, MO; brothers, Herman Adams of Conway, AR and Guy Adams of Washington; and numerous grandchildren, greatgrandchildren, and great-greatgrandchildren.
Memorial service was Wednesday, July 11, 2007 at Coffman Funeral Home Chapel in Harrison. Burial of her cremated remains followed in Tomahawk Cemetery at St. Joe.
